Abstract

PURPOSE:To make it possible to select a spray pattern from a nozzle in conformity to what is required with regards to a cleaning device designed to clean the local parts of a human body and a cleaning nozzle thereof. CONSTITUTION:This cleaning device provides a water quantity variable means 15, a main nozzle 18 and a sub-nozzle 19 which has a spray cross section different from the main nozzle 18, a cleaning nozzle which allows the sub-nozzle 19 to be on/off controlled in conformity with the pressure of water to be supplied and a first water force setting means which supplies a signal to the water quantity variable means 15 and sets the water force of cleaning water to be sprayed from the cleaning nozzle 17 in several stages and a second water force setting means 22 which sets stronger water force than the strongest water force available in the first water force setting means 21 and opens the sub-nozzle 19. When the first water force setting means 21 is selected, the cleaning water is sprayed only from the main nozzle 18 and the water force can be controlled in several stages. When the second water force setting means is selected, the cleaning water is sprayed from both the main and sub-nozzles are the cleaning pattern can be changed as well.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a cleaning device used for sanitary cleaning toilet seats and the like for cleaning a human body part, and a cleaning nozzle suitable for the device.

2. Description of the Related Art Conventionally, as this type of cleaning apparatus for cleaning a human body, a cleaning nozzle having a single or a plurality of nozzle holes is used to spray hot water to intensively clean a local area.
Alternatively, as shown in FIG. 5 and FIG. 6, there is one that can use a fluid oscillation element having a feedback channel to perform a relatively wide range of cleaning by the water spraying effect.

In the above structure, cleaning water is attached to the wall 1 for example.
When attached to the 0 side and jetted out to the arrow A side, the washing water flows into the feedback channel 12 side, pressure is applied to the washing water jetted to the arrow A side from the side surface, and the running water is moved to the attachment wall 11 side. Eject from B side. By repeating this state, the self-oscillation state occurs. As a result, a cleaning effect and a water spraying effect can be obtained even with a relatively small amount of water.

In the conventional cleaning device as described above, it is possible to intensively wash each of them or to wash the local periphery in a dispersed manner, but it is not possible to use both of them according to preference. There was a problem called.

That is, since this type of cleaning device has a plurality of users, a comfortable cleaning mode differs depending on sex, age, individual difference, physical condition and the like. Therefore, the water pressure is generally variable, but the water pressure is adjusted in the same pattern, so that the desired comfortable cleaning form may not always be obtained. Particularly in the case of local washing of women, there is a difference in the washing form required for normal hygiene during the period of menstruation and that required for ordinary washing, and improvement is desired.

(1) It is possible to use the simple structure of providing the second water flow setting means to adjust the water flow of the cleaning water and selectively use the cleaning jet pattern such as concentration or dispersion according to the preference.
It is possible to expand the selection range of the comfortable cleaning mode according to gender, individual difference, physical condition, etc. in the human body local cleaning. (2) Since the ejection pattern can be changed by controlling the water pressure or the water pressure in the cleaning nozzle, the switching of the ejection pattern can be remotely controlled. This is suitable as a sanitary washing toilet seat cleaning device of this type that is delivered to a local position when in use and retracted into the device when not in use. In addition, since the water flow control uses the existing water amount varying means in combination, a special actuator member for pattern switching can be eliminated. (3) Since the nozzles capable of jetting with different cleaning patterns such as concentration and dispersion are integrally configured, the nozzle structure can be simplified and made compact. Further, the cleaning effect can be improved by combining the concentrated cleaning and the distributed cleaning. (4) In the cleaning nozzle, since the flow path is switched from the main nozzle opening only to the main nozzle opening and from both the main and sub nozzle openings, the nozzle pressure is increased even when the water pressure inside the nozzle is increased to switch from concentrated to distributed cleaning. The increase in the opening area of the nozzle can prevent the ejection speed from the nozzle from significantly increasing, and as a result, the feeling of cleaning can be improved.
